Yuma is an old girl who enjoys curling up on the couch, watching TV, going for walks in the woods, and getting belly rubs. We have had her for 10 years now. We originally adopted her from a shelter in Virginia where she had been given up by her original family due to anxiety issues around children which led to her urinating in the house. She did well in our home with minimal issues for many years until we had our own children. Once our eldest arrived, her rare accidents became frequent. We now have a 3 yr old and a new baby and she is unable to tolerate children crying and has become fear aggressive around our toddler. We have been struggling to manage and have come to the heartbreaking decision that we can't keep her. We want to find her a quiet home without any children or other pets and someone who is home a lot. Ideally, she would be with someone who is retired or works from home as she does not do well being in the house for long stretches of time alone.
